Make sure you export any tourney results, custom huds, bonuses/rakeback, and hud notes also.

Export Your Notes - http://faq.holdemmanager.com/images/notes-02.jpg

Export Your Bonuses and Rakeback - Options > Rakeback & Bonuses - http://faq.holdemmanager.com/images/...bonuses-01.jpg

Export any tourney summaries by selecting all your tournaments in the Data View Sub-Tab of the Tourney > Results Menu and choose Export Tourney Results and summaries

http://faq.holdemmanager.com/images/...ta-view-01.jpg

Make sure you export any custom HUD layouts to your \Config folder and copy it for a backup. http://faq.holdemmanager.com/questio...ort+HUD+Layout

and finally:

Export your hands and then open the new database and import them into that - http://faq.holdemmanager.com/questio...6+Export+Hands

Once the Hands are imported you can import the Tourney Results and Bonuses/Rakeback

The Import From Folder/File(s) methods are only for importing bulk and/or old hand histories. When using the manual methods HM does not archive those files.

Auto Import is used when playing to import the hands every 5 seconds and keep the HUD current. You need to make sure you setup/verify the settings in the Options > Configure Auto Import Folders settings. This is where HM checks every 5 seconds for new hands/files. After those files are 15 minutes old they are moved tot he \HMArchive for performance reasons. If they were to not be moved it woukld eventually create a huge workload for the HMImport every 5 seconds and the HUD would likely not appear at all.

Your \HMArchive is likely not in your \Holdem Manager directory. We normally suggest you use C:\HMArchive, but you may have put it anywhere.

To verify the location: Options > Configure Auto Import Folders > Edit > Archive Folder: ___________________

http://faq.holdemmanager.com/questio...Import+Folders

The archive should be organized by \Month\DayOfMonth (example: D:\HMArchive\2009\07\31).
